The most substantial drawback of getting a sequence drive is noise. Most manufacturers purpose to make their scooters as tranquil as is possible. On the other hand, if noise is a priority in your case, then Select a belt-driven scooter. These are whisper-tranquil, but they won’t last as long as a series.

Electric scooters and hoverboards have received popularity in recent years In spite of a ban of their use on carriageways, footpaths and cycle tracks under the Road Traffic Ordinance, with offences punishable by a HK£5,000 fine and three months�?jail.
